Abstract

The somatic embryos in duced from mature somatic embryo green cotyledon of two cassava cultivar SC5 and SC6. The slab polyacrylamide gel electrophoresis of esteraae (EST) and amylase isozyme were carried out with the explants cultured for 0, 5, 10, 20 and 30 d. The results showed that expression of esterase isozymes between two cassava cultivars (SC5 and SC6) were different. The mobility of electrophoretic band E2, E3 in SG5 was different to thai in SC6. These differences may be caused by variety Cassava Cultivars. In SC5, E3 was the strongest expression band during the development of somatic embryo, while in SC6, il was E'4 band. The differences of Amylase isozyme between SC5 and SC6 were that, three bands have been observed during the development of SC5 somatic embryos, while in SC6 there was only one band. When the explants were cultured for 5 d, the amylase got the strongest expression in SC5, while in SC6 it was got in the explants cultured for 0 and 20 d.
